Output 68be5752677f4246b475c015560ab004b06b5e105070bdd07241ff4da7ebb63c:1

value
9989521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3eac740c75efa6c9a5c7a0ead415a241fd4fe6 OP_EQUAL
address
3EPGvrDjyQNBci55q1YNTGUAUSeZDJ3f5h
transaction
68be5752677f4246b475c015560ab004b06b5e105070bdd07241ff4da7ebb63c
confirmations
233592
spent
true